中考题库矢量化

تم الإنشاء في: ٢١ نوفمبر ٢٠٢٤

تمت الإجابة باستخدام O1 Preview بواسطة Chat01

سؤال

如何将中考数学真题试卷转化为矢量数据库,作为coze平台aibot的知识库,以便豆包大模型进行查阅调用

الفكرة

将资料转化为数据库

转化操作步骤

首先收集数据,然后进行预处理和文本编码,最后建立向量库并与czoze平台的aibot集成,确保大模型Doubao可以访问和利用向量库。

转换为向量数据库

将初中数学试卷转换为向量数据库,用于与Coze平台的aibot和Doubao大模型搭配使用。

الإجابة

要将中考数学真题试卷转化为矢量数据库,作为 Coze 平台 AIbot 的知识库,供豆包大模型查阅调用,可以按照以下步骤进行:

1. 数据收集与整理

  • 收集试卷:获取历年中考数学真题试卷,确保题目多样性和全面性。
  • 数字化处理:如果试卷是纸质的,使用 OCR 工具(如 PaddleOCR、Tesseract)将其转化为可编辑的电子文本。
  • 格式清洗:清理文本中的噪音,统一格式,确保数据质量。

2. 数据标注与分类

  • 题目分类:根据知识点、题型、难度等对题目进行分类和标注,方便后续检索。
  • 添加元数据:包括年份、地区、试卷类型等信息。

3. 文本向量化

  • 选择预训练模型:使用适合中文的预训练模型,如 BERT、RoBERTa、ERNIE 等。
  • 生成向量表示:将每个题目文本输入模型,获取其高维向量表示。

4. 构建矢量数据库

  • 选择矢量数据库:如 Milvus、Faiss、Pinecone 等,支持高效的向量检索。
  • 数据导入:将题目向量和元数据导入数据库,建立索引。

5. 集成到 Coze 平台 AIbot

  • API 接口开发:开发接口,使 AIbot 能与矢量数据库交互,进行相似度检索。
  • 查询优化:根据用户输入,生成查询向量,检索相关题目。

6. 豆包大模型的调用

  • 模型集成:将豆包大模型与 AIbot 连接,使其能利用检索结果生成答案或提供参考。
  • 上下文处理:确保模型理解用户意图和检索内容,提供准确回答。

7. 测试与优化

  • 功能测试:验证整个流程的可用性和稳定性。
  • 性能优化:根据反馈,优化检索速度和模型响应时间。

8. 部署与维护

  • 系统部署:将完整的解决方案部署到生产环境。
  • 持续更新:定期更新题库,维护模型性能。

注意事项

  • 版权问题:确保试卷数据的合法使用,避免侵权。
  • 数据安全:保护用户隐私和数据安全,遵守相关法律法规。
  • 用户体验:关注交互界面和响应质量,提升用户满意度。

工具与资源推荐

  • OCR 工具:PaddleOCR、Tesseract。
  • 预训练模型:Hugging Face Transformers。
  • 矢量数据库:Milvus、Faiss。

通过以上步骤,您可以成功地将中考数学真题试卷转化为矢量数据库,供 Coze 平台 AIbot 和豆包大模型查阅调用,实现高效的知识检索与应用。

مشاركة هذا السؤال والجواب